The Samondake Unit of the Mino Terrane in central Japan is characterized by a large quantity of sandstone. The Samondake Unit in the Neo-Izumi area is divided into the Subunit A and Subunit B on the basis of features in lithology, structure and deformation. The Subunit A is situated structurally higher than the Subunit B, and they are in fault contact each other. Radiolarian age of the Samondake Unit ranges from Middle Triassic to middle Middle Jurassic time. However middle Middle Jurassic radiolarians which characterize the Tricolocapsa plicarum zone (Matsuoka, 1995) are obtained from siliceous mudstone and mudstone of both Subunit A and B, early Middle Jurassic radiolarians which characterize the Laxtorum(?) jurassicum zone are obtained from only some siliceous mudstone of the Subunit A. Both Subunit A and B are considered to have been formed in the subduction accretion process on the basis of the ages and structural relationship of the two units.
